Overview of Eastlight at 501 Third Avenue

Conveniently located at the nexus of Kips Bay and Murray Hill, Eastlight is a shimmering 34-story condominium with iconic views of the Chrysler Building, Midtown skyline, and the East River. Designed by CetraRuddy Architects, the cantilevered design is encased in sound-attenuated floor-to-ceiling windows that maximize light and lend a feeling of openness to each residence.

All layouts, ranging from studios to two-bedrooms, feature 9’ ceilings, 7” wide white oak flooring, satin nickel doors, and in-unit washer/dryers. Certain layouts include flexible spaces that can be used as a home office, nursery, or a personal fitness/creative studio.

An elegantly designed amenity suite on the 34th floor makes the most of panoramic skyline and river views while allowing residents to unwind and engage. Offerings include a fitness center with state-of-the-art equipment and a training studio, a lounge, a game room, a private dining room, and an outdoor roof terrace with grills.

Eastlight benefits from a central Manhattan location on the corner of Third Avenue and East 34th Street. The building is a short distance from the Morgan Library & Museum, popular NoMad and Murray Hill restaurants, Fairway, Trader Joe's, the Kips Bay AMC movie theater, and Grand Central.
